Flying from Worcester Regional Airport (ORH) to Orlando International Airport (MCO): what you need to know
The average length of a direct flight from Worcester Regional Airport to Orlando International Airport is 3 hours 10 minutes.
Worcester and Orlando follow the same timezone, UTC-4.
You can choose from six weekly Worcester Regional Airport to Orlando International Airport flights. The 13:05 departure with JetBlue Airways is the earliest flight you can take. JetBlue Airways operates the last service of the day at 16:40.
Your ORH to MCO flight won't wait if you're running late, so show up at the airport on time. Arrive up to one hour in advance for domestic flights and two hours ahead when you're travelling internationally.
Flying during a peak time like April? Major public holidays and other popular seasons can lead to longer queues at security. Play things extra safe and arrive up to four hours ahead of international flights and two hours before a domestic departure.

Handy information about Worcester Regional Airport (ORH)
You'll find ORH at 375 Airport Drive.
When it comes to the on-time performance of Worcester Regional Airport, 73.01% of flights arrive within the expected timeframe.
Central Worcester to Worcester Regional Airport is around 8 kilometres. Depending on traffic, it'll take about 15 minutes to get there if you're driving, ride-sharing or catching a cab.
The trip on public transport will take about 1 hour 20 minutes.

When to fly to Orlando International Airport (MCO)
It's time to pick your travel dates for your flight from Worcester Regional Airport to Orlando International Airport. July is the busiest month to head to Orlando. If you prefer a more laid-back vibe, go in May.
When reserving your flight from Worcester Regional Airport to Orlando International Airport, consider the type of weather you like. July is the warmest month in Orlando, with temperatures ranging from 23ºC to 34ºC.
January sees average temperatures of between 7ºC and 23ºC. Look for cheap tickets from ORH to MCO sometime around then if you like travelling in cooler conditions.
